Break Room Areas

Filming is an endurance game. A single scene might take hours—or even days—to perfect, and when the cast and crew are working under the hot sun, a little shade goes a long way. Converted shipping containers make ideal break areas. They’re easy to transport, can be outfitted with air conditioning, and provide a cool, quiet space to recharge between takes. Whether it’s sipping water or escaping the heat, these sturdy boxes make comfort mobile.

Dressing Rooms

While lead actors often have custom trailers, shipping containers are perfect for accommodating extras or crew members who also need a place to change or freshen up. With the right modifications, a standard container can be divided into multiple dressing rooms, each offering privacy and practicality in a compact footprint. It’s a great way to maximize space without compromising convenience.

Office Areas

A film set doesn’t run itself. Behind the lights and cameras is a busy crew managing logistics, scheduling, and communication. Shipping containers are easily converted into on-site offices, offering a secure, weatherproof space for production managers, coordinators, and other essential personnel. With power, internet, and climate control, these mobile offices keep the whole production running smoothly.

On the Big Screen

Sometimes, shipping containers aren’t just part of the set—they are the set. These recognizable steel giants are often featured in films, especially when the story takes characters to docks, shipping yards, or industrial zones. Blockbusters like Batman Begins and Finding Dory feature scenes with shipping containers. And who could forget Pacific Rim, where a towering robot turned a pair of containers into brass knuckles to deliver a knockout punch? Talk about packing a punch!

Green Rooms

A green room is where talent waits before heading on set—it’s meant to be a calm, comfortable space to relax, prepare, and mentally focus before a scene. On location, building a traditional green room isn’t always feasible, but a modified shipping container offers the perfect solution. With some insulation, climate control, cozy furniture, and a few personal touches, a container can be transformed into a stylish, private lounge that meets even the most high-profile stars’ expectations. Portable, secure, and fully customizable, it’s a green room that goes wherever the production needs it.
